Products from the reaction of C60F18 with sarcosine and aldehydes: the Prato reactio

摘要

Various pyrrolidinofullerenes (both mono- and bis-addition products) have been isolated from the reaction betweenntoluene solutions of C60F18, N-methyl-2-aminoethanoic acid (sarcosine) and either formaldehyde or benzaldehyde.nBoth mono- and bis-addition products were obtained and either partially of fully characterised. The main mono-naddition product from the reaction with formaldehyde was also obtained from reactions with the other aldehydes,nindicating that formaldehyde may be present in sarcosine, or generated from it through in situ oxidation by thenfullerene. The main mono-addition product from reaction of C60F18 with toluene solutions of sarcosine andnbenzaldehyde was obtained also in the absence of benzaldehyde. This anomaly was traced to the presence ofnbenzaldehyde (0.05%) in HPLC grade toluene, which may be increased by oxidation of toluene during thenreaction conditions.
